Nearshore Software Development in Mexico: Unlocking Cost-Efficiency and Top Talent

In a world where tech talent is as sought after as the last slice of pizza at a party, nearshore software development in Mexico is stealing the spotlight. With a perfect blend of skilled developers and a time zone that won’t leave you groggy at 3 AM, it’s no wonder companies are flocking south of the border.

Overview of Nearshore Software Development

Nearshore software development in Mexico has gained traction among businesses seeking efficient tech solutions. Proximity significantly enhances collaboration, allowing real-time communication. This geographical advantage leads to faster project turnaround times.

The pool of skilled developers in Mexico numbers over 500,000, making it a prime source of tech talent. Many graduates from local universities specialize in software engineering and related fields. English proficiency among developers rates higher compared to other Latin American countries, facilitating smoother interactions with clients.

Cost savings represent another attractive benefit. Companies can save 30% to 50% on labor costs by outsourcing to Mexico instead of onshore options. The combination of top-tier talent and lower expenses makes it appealing for various industries.

Cultural similarities often improve the working relationship between U.S. companies and Mexican teams. Countries share similar work ethics and business practices, minimizing the adjustment period for collaboration. Additionally, many Mexican developers enjoy familiarity with Western technology trends, further enhancing their adaptability.

Competitive solutions emerge from a collaborative environment. Developers commonly integrate agile methodologies, leading to efficient project management. Firms can expect regular updates and the ability to pivot quickly as project requirements evolve.

With all these factors, Mexico stands out as a leading destination for nearshore software development. The intersection of skilled talent, cost efficiency, and cultural alignment sets Mexico apart in the global tech landscape.

Advantages of Nearshore Software Development in Mexico

Nearshore software development in Mexico offers numerous advantages that enhance efficiency and collaboration for businesses. The following sections highlight key benefits for companies considering this approach.

Cost Efficiency

Significant cost savings occur when outsourcing to Mexico. Companies often reduce labor costs by 30% to 50% compared to hiring onshore. These savings stem from lower wage expectations yet do not compromise quality. High-caliber software engineers available in Mexico contribute their expertise at competitive rates. Firms can allocate these financial resources toward other essential business areas, enhancing overall productivity.

Cultural Compatibility

Cultural similarities play a vital role in the success of collaboration between U.S. and Mexican teams. Shared work ethics and business practices lead to smoother interactions and stronger partnerships. Many Mexican developers are well-versed in Western technology trends, fostering a collaborative spirit. This alignment eases understanding and improves communication, ensuring projects progress efficiently.

Proximity and Time Zone Benefits

Proximity to the U.S. significantly enhances real-time communication. Mexico’s time zone closely aligns with that of the United States, facilitating prompt feedback and collaboration. Businesses can convene meetings during regular work hours, making it easier to discuss project updates and resolve issues quickly. This accessibility shortens project turnaround times and allows teams to adapt rapidly to changing requirements.

Popular Technologies Used

Nearshore software development in Mexico emphasizes modern technology trends and innovative practices. Developers leverage popular programming languages, frameworks, and tools to meet diverse client needs efficiently.

Trends in Software Development

Agile methodologies dominate the development landscape in Mexico, fostering adaptive and quick responses to changing project requirements. Companies increasingly prioritize DevOps practices to enhance collaboration between development and operations teams. Additionally, cloud computing technologies are gaining traction, enabling scalable solutions and improved resource management. Machine learning and artificial intelligence also see considerable interest, as organizations seek to leverage data-driven insights to optimize processes.

Emerging Technologies in Mexico

Blockchain technology emerges as a game-changer for sectors such as finance and supply chain management. Many developers are exploring Internet of Things solutions, connecting everyday devices to gather and analyze data. Furthermore, progressive web applications gain popularity due to their ability to deliver exceptional user experiences without heavy investments in native apps. Cybersecurity remains a focal point, as businesses prioritize safeguarding data while embracing digital transformations.

Key Players in the Mexican Market

Mexico’s software development market boasts several key players, contributing to its growing prominence in nearshore solutions. Numerous firms, both large and small, drive innovation and collaboration across the industry.

Leading Companies

Leading companies in the Mexican software development space include firms like Softtek and Cognizant. Softtek, founded in 1982, has become a global player by offering IT services that cater to diverse business needs. Cognizant, another major player, specializes in tech solutions, emphasizing digital transformation. Companies such as Bincard and Nearshore Nexus exemplify the strength of smaller firms, delivering personalized services and agile methodologies. These organizations leverage local talent to meet market demands effectively, providing quality solutions at competitive prices.

Startup Ecosystem

The startup ecosystem in Mexico thrives, nurturing new ideas and technologies. Innovative startups such as Kueski and Bitso are making waves in fintech, demonstrating the region’s potential. Areas like Guadalajara and Mexico City serve as tech hubs, attracting investments and fostering collaboration. Accelerators and incubators support budding entrepreneurs, creating an environment ripe for technological advancements. Local universities also contribute by producing skilled graduates ready to enter the workforce. This dynamic ecosystem cultivates a spirit of innovation, positioning Mexico as a hotbed for software development opportunities.

Challenges and Considerations

Nearshore software development in Mexico presents specific challenges that companies must address. Understanding these considerations can help optimize collaboration and project outcomes.

Language Barriers

Language proficiency often poses challenges in nearshore partnerships. Although many developers in Mexico excel in English, communication gaps may still occur. Misinterpretations can lead to project delays. Frequent interactions can help mitigate misunderstandings, fostering clear dialogue. Companies might benefit from utilizing bilingual project managers to bridge gaps effectively. Establishing a supportive environment encourages developers to ask questions without hesitation, enhancing collaboration. Investing in language training can further strengthen communication skills for tech teams.

Infrastructure Issues

Infrastructure development varies across regions in Mexico. Certain areas lack the robust internet connectivity required for seamless project execution. Companies should assess the locales of potential partners to ensure consistent access to necessary resources. Urban centers like Guadalajara and Mexico City typically have better infrastructure; however, not all regions offer the same reliability. Regular assessments of network speeds and capabilities can identify potential risks. Working with vendors familiar with local challenges also aids in addressing infrastructure concerns effectively. Prioritizing locations with sufficient tech infrastructure encourages smoother project management and faster delivery timelines.

Conclusion

Nearshore software development in Mexico presents a compelling opportunity for businesses seeking to enhance their tech capabilities. The combination of skilled developers and favorable time zones streamlines collaboration and accelerates project timelines. Cost savings further bolster its appeal while cultural similarities foster strong working relationships.

As companies navigate the evolving tech landscape, Mexico’s innovative practices and emerging technologies position it as a key player. While challenges like language barriers and infrastructure must be addressed, the benefits of partnering with Mexican developers are undeniable. Ultimately, Mexico’s vibrant tech ecosystem makes it an ideal choice for organizations aiming to drive growth and efficiency through strategic software development partnerships.

You may also like